Yesterday, I finally got up into an old gnarly oak that's living right next to my house. I've put off climbing it cause my husband started to build a tree house in it (I tried, but could not dissuade him) and never finished it. The partially built platform makes it awkward to gain access. Anyway, I shot a line with my sidewinder and got a great setting in the top of the tree. My rope was hanging 8 or 10 feet off the trunk so it was an open air climb. This tree has lots of holes, nooks and crannies, so I was aware there could be critters living there and tried to climb as quietly as possible so as not to disturb anyone. As I came eye level (but not close up) with a fairly large tree cave, I looked in, and surprise! a baby owl! I snapped a couple of pics and climbed on. I was happy mom wasn't home.
The canopy of this tree will be great fun to play in - lots of potential for short and longer traverses. I didn't have a lot of time this trip (plus I wanted to get down before mom owl returned), but am looking forward to getting back in it once the little guy has had time to grow up.
